CHICAGO — A 27-year-old man was wounded in a shooting in Little Village Saturday, police said.

At 4:17 p.m., he was driving a vehicle in the 2300 block of South Harding Avenue when someone in a beige SUV pulled up alongside him and began shooting before driving off, police said.

He was grazed in his forehead and was taken to Mount Sinai Hospital in good condition, police said.

The man was a documented gang member, police said.

No one was in custody.
